Personalized Learning Experiences Through AI

Adaptive Learning Platforms

AI can create customized learning experiences tailored to each student’s needs. Adaptive learning platforms adjust the content based on how a student learns best. For example, platforms like DreamBox and Knewton personalize math and reading exercises to fit individual learning speeds. A study by the Bill & Melinda Gates Foundation found that personalized learning can boost student achievement by 30% or more.

AI-Driven Assessment and Feedback

AI enhances the assessment process by providing immediate feedback to students. This system allows teachers to focus on more critical teaching tasks. Tools like Gradescope and Turnitin can quickly grade assignments, showing students where they need improvement. Quick, targeted feedback helps students understand their strengths and weaknesses.

Intelligent Tutoring Systems

AI tutors serve as extra help for students who may need more support. Intelligent tutoring systems like Carnegie Learning provide tailored assistance in subjects like math. Data shows these systems can improve learning outcomes, with students scoring 20% higher on assessments after using these tools.

Automating Administrative Tasks for Educators

Automated Grading and Feedback

Grading can take a lot of a teacher's time. AI can help by automatically grading multiple-choice quizzes and homework. Tools like Auto-Grader help save hours each week, allowing teachers to invest more time in lesson planning and student engagement.

Streamlining Administrative Processes

AI can also simplify administrative tasks. Programs like SchoolMint and ClassDojo help with scheduling, tracking attendance, and communicating with parents. These systems make schools run more efficiently, letting educators focus on teaching rather than paperwork.

Data Analysis and Insights

AI plays a crucial role in analyzing student data. By evaluating attendance records, grades, and participation, AI can identify students who may be struggling. Schools can use these insights to provide targeted interventions and support for at-risk students.

Enhancing Accessibility and Inclusivity in Education

AI-Powered Translation and Language Support

Language barriers can hinder learning. AI can help break these down through translation tools like Google Translate. Such technologies allow students from diverse backgrounds to engage more fully with the content, enhancing inclusivity in classrooms.

Personalized Learning for Students with Disabilities

AI offers unique opportunities for students with disabilities. Tools like Kurzweil 3000 customize lessons for various learning styles, ensuring that every student has a chance to succeed. This tailored support can significantly improve learning experiences for these students.

Expanding Access to Education in Remote Areas

AI-powered online platforms allow education to reach students in remote locations. Programs like Khan Academy offer curriculum access to areas lacking proper educational resources. These platforms provide quality learning experiences regardless of geographical location.

Virtual Tutors and Assistants: Revolutionizing Student Support

AI-powered virtual tutors and assistants are transforming education by providing students with instant access to guidance and support anytime, anywhere. These tools leverage Natural Language Processing (NLP) and Machine Learning (ML) to simulate human-like interactions, enabling students to engage with technology as if they were interacting with a teacher or tutor.

Key Features of Virtual Tutors and Assistants

1. 24/7 Availability:

Unlike human tutors, virtual assistants are always accessible. This ensures students can get help with homework, clarify doubts, or learn new concepts outside of regular school hours.

2. Interactive Learning:

AI tutors can engage students in interactive lessons, using conversational tones and adaptive responses to make the learning process feel more natural and personalized.

3. Feedback and Progress Tracking:

Virtual tutors analyze a student’s progress over time, offering tailored feedback. They identify weak areas and provide targeted resources to help students improve.

Examples in Action

ChatGPT and Other AI Tools:

Students use conversational AI like ChatGPT to ask questions about a subject, get writing advice, or even solve mathematical problems in real time.

Sophia by Pearson:

A digital tutor designed to assist with specific course materials, offering interactive problem-solving and progress insights.

Google’s AI Assistant:

Acts as a versatile tool to explain concepts, summarize research topics, or even manage study schedules.

Advantages Over Traditional Tutoring

Cost-Effectiveness:

Virtual tutors are often more affordable than hiring human tutors, making quality education accessible to more students.

Scalability:

A single AI tutor can support thousands of students simultaneously without compromising the quality of assistance.

Personalization:

AI systems adapt to individual learning styles, creating custom-tailored educational experiences that might not be feasible in group tutoring sessions.

Challenges to Consider

Lack of Emotional Understanding:

While AI can mimic conversation, it lacks the empathy and cultural sensitivity that human educators bring to learning.

Dependence on Technology:

Over-reliance on virtual tutors might limit critical thinking or problem-solving skills that come from traditional learning methods.

Data Privacy Concerns:

Virtual tutors collect and process student data, raising concerns about how this data is stored and used.

Virtual tutors and assistants are a glimpse into the future of education, bridging gaps in accessibility and enhancing personalized learning. However, their integration must balance the benefits of automation with the irreplaceable value of human mentorship.

AI in Educational Administration: Streamlining the Backbone of Education

Artificial Intelligence is not just reshaping classrooms but also transforming the behind-the-scenes operations that keep educational institutions running smoothly. By automating routine tasks and optimizing processes, AI in educational administration allows schools, colleges, and universities to operate more efficiently and effectively.

How AI Supports Educational Administration

1. Automated Grading and Assessment:

Grading assignments and tests is a time-consuming task. AI-powered tools like Gradescope and ExamSoft evaluate student work, including multiple-choice and essay-based responses. This not only saves teachers time but also ensures consistent and unbiased grading.

2. Streamlining Admissions Processes:

AI algorithms can analyze student applications, automatically sorting them based on eligibility criteria or specific parameters like test scores, extracurricular achievements, and recommendations. This reduces administrative burdens and speeds up decision-making.

3. Student Record Management:

AI systems organize and analyze vast amounts of student data, such as attendance, performance, and behavior patterns. Administrators can use this data to identify trends, predict outcomes, and make data-driven decisions.

4. Scheduling and Resource Allocation:

AI tools like Microsoft Scheduler or AI-driven timetabling systems optimize schedules for classes, exams, and meetings. They consider factors like faculty availability, classroom occupancy, and student preferences to create conflict-free schedules.

5. Improved Communication:

Chatbots and virtual assistants like Ivy.ai or AdmitHub are increasingly used by institutions to handle inquiries from students and parents. These AI-powered systems provide instant responses to common questions, reducing the load on administrative staff.

Benefits of AI in Administration

  • Increased Efficiency:

          Automating repetitive tasks frees up time for educators and staff to focus on more strategic responsibilities.

  • Cost Savings:

     By reducing manual labor and optimizing processes, AI helps institutions save money on administrative overhead.

  • Enhanced Decision-Making:

      AI systems provide actionable insights through data analysis, enabling administrators to make informed decisions regarding student success, resource allocation, and policy implementation.

  • Scalability:

     AI can handle increasing workloads as institutions grow, ensuring that administrative processes remain smooth even during peak times like admissions or exam periods.

Challenges to Address

1. Data Security and Privacy:

Educational institutions handle sensitive student data. AI systems must comply with regulations like GDPR or FERPA to ensure data protection and ethical use.

2. Resistance to Change:

The adoption of AI in administration may face resistance from staff unfamiliar with the technology, requiring training and gradual integration.

3. Cost of Implementation:

While AI can reduce costs in the long term, the initial investment in AI tools and infrastructure can be significant.

4. Potential Errors:

Errors in AI systems, such as misclassification of student records, could disrupt administrative processes. Human oversight remains critical to avoid such issues.

Future of AI in Administration

The role of AI in educational administration will continue to grow. Emerging applications, such as predictive analytics, may help institutions identify at-risk students early and provide tailored interventions. Additionally, advanced AI tools may integrate seamlessly with existing systems, further improving efficiency and decision-making.

By embracing AI in administration, educational institutions can create a foundation that supports innovation in teaching and learning, ultimately enhancing the overall educational experience.

Addressing Ethical Concerns and Challenges of AI in Education

Data Privacy and Security

With great power comes great responsibility. The use of AI raises important questions about data privacy. Schools must protect student information and use AI responsibly. Following regulations like FERPA and practicing transparent data collection can help maintain trust.

Bias and Fairness in AI Algorithms

AI systems can sometimes reflect biases present in their training data. It's crucial to develop fair algorithms to ensure equal opportunities for all students. Ongoing monitoring and adjustments can help reduce bias and support fair outcomes in education.

Teacher Training and Professional Development

Integrating AI into teaching requires proper training for educators. Professional development programs can equip teachers with the skills needed to use AI effectively. Continuous support is vital for maximizing the benefits of these new tools.

Emerging Technologies and Applications

The future holds exciting possibilities for AI in education. Technologies like virtual reality (VR) and augmented reality (AR) could create immersive learning experiences. Additionally, blockchain might enhance credentialing and record-keeping.

Collaboration Between Humans and AI

It's essential to view AI as a helpful tool rather than a replacement for teachers. Human interaction remains vital in education. Combining AI's efficiency with teachers' insights can lead to richer learning experiences.
